East Timor Renewable Energy Industry Analysis
Renewable energy is an important topic for many nations, including East Timor. The country has a small economy and is heavily dependent on oil and gas for its energy needs. However, there is growing interest in renewable energy as a way to diversify the energy mix and reduce reliance on fossil fuels.
Currently, the renewable energy sector in East Timor is still in its early stages, with limited installed capacity. However, there are several major drivers for renewable energy development in the country. One of the main drivers is the need to reduce the country's dependence on imported fossil fuels, which can be expensive and subject to price volatility. Additionally, renewable energy can help to improve energy security and provide access to electricity in remote areas.
Hydropower is the most developed renewable energy source in East Timor, with the Laclo hydropower plant providing around 20% of the country's electricity needs. The government has plans to expand hydropower capacity, with the construction of the Builico hydropower plant currently underway. Other potential sources of renewable energy in East Timor include solar, wind, and biomass. The government has plans to develop solar power plants in several locations across the country and has identified wind energy potential in some coastal areas.
Despite the potential for renewable energy in East Timor, there are several challenges to its development. Limited technical expertise and financial resources are major barriers, as is the lack of a clear regulatory framework for renewable energy. In addition, the country's small market size and low energy demand can make it difficult to attract investment in renewable energy projects.
However, there are reasons for optimism about the future of renewable energy in East Timor. The government has made renewable energy a priority and has developed a National Energy Policy that includes targets for renewable energy development. International organizations, such as the World Bank, are also providing support for renewable energy projects in the country.
In conclusion, the renewable energy sector in East Timor is still in its early stages, but there is growing interest in developing renewable energy sources to diversify the energy mix and reduce dependence on fossil fuels. While there are challenges to its development, the government has made renewable energy a priority and there is potential for further growth in the sector in the future.
